PORT MAGPIES:
IN: Callum Wilson (West Coast Eagles), James Brain (Sydney Reserves), Brendan Ah Chee (Mini Draft – Power), Ben Haren (Sydney / Returning), Ryan Mackenzie (North Ballarat), Cade Wellington (Ocen Grove), Bryan Beinke (Norwood Reserves Coach)
OUT: Terry Milera (St. Kilda), Michael Clinch (North Adelaide), Kerran Hall (North Adelaide), Ivan Maric (Richmond), Matthew Lokan (Retired), Kristian DePasquale (Retired), Isaac Weetra (West), Xavier Watson (South Adelaide).
Seems unusual that 4 players have moved on from the Maggies to try their luck at other opposition sides? Perhaps this has flown under the radar a little with so much attention on Glenelg in this area in recent times.
Tony Bamford is someone I very much rate as an SANFL coach, by most of the SANFL experts reasoning, Port should have been bottom of the ladder last season, yet with minimal recruiting they well and truly punched above their weight last year and gave several fancied SANFL sides more than just a bloody nose when it counted.
Wilson, Brain and Haren are very good signings for the club, some vic players make it, others dont in the SANFL, a 50% strike rate seems about right in this area. No names as yet for local signings of which there may be several as a number from their metro and country zones are training for a place on the league list at present.
Perhaps as it stands Port appear to lose more than they have gained, I should rate them to fall back a spot, but I wont, something just tells me that Port are an up and coming side and will continue to gain momentum in 2012 and will be a very good chance for the five no doubt as a chagrin to many. Would love nothing more than an up and coming Magpies side to get a go at a knockout final against Central, good time for some old scores to be settled one might think!
